Rangers and Joey Barton have agreed to part ways.
The Scottish giants and the veteran midfielder have been at loggerheads since the player was banned in September for breaching club discipline.
Sky Sports suggests that the club and the former Newcastle United, Manchester City, QPR, Marseille and Burnley man have agreed a severance package which will be finalised before being announced on Wednesday.
34-year-old Barton only joined 'Gers from Burnley in May on a two-year deal but found himself in hot water after questioning the team following a 5-1 loss to Glasgow rivals Celtic in the Scottish Cup.
He was initially banned from the club for three weeks before that was extended, but has now agreed to leave Ibrox having made just eight appearances.
